Triple Chocolate Zucchini Loaf, Or Muffins
- 2 (1 ounce) unsweetened chocolate squares
- 3 eggs
- 2 cups white sugar
- 1 cup vegetable oil
- 2 1/2 cups zucchini (grated)
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 3/4 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 tablespoon cocoa
- 1 cup sour cream
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ease two 9X5 inch loaf pans, or 24 muffin tins. In a microwave-safe bowl, microwave chocolate until melted. Stir occasionally until chocolate is smooth.
- In a large bowl, combine eggs, sugar, oil, grated zucchini, vanilla, sour cream, and chocolate; beat well.
- In another bowl combine fl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, cocoa, and chocolate chips. Add to the egg mixture.
- Pour batter into prepared loaf pans.
- Bake in preheated oven for 60 to 70 minutes,(25 minutes for muffins), or until a toothpick inserted into the center of a loaf comes out clean.
- Cool, slice, and enjoy!
